Will AI replace Event Decorator jobs in 2026? High Risk risk (57%)
AI is poised to impact event decorators through various avenues. LLMs can assist with brainstorming themes and generating creative concepts, while computer vision can analyze spaces and suggest optimal layouts. Robotics and automation can handle repetitive tasks like setting up tables and arranging decorations, potentially increasing efficiency but also displacing some manual labor.

Event Decorators should focus on developing these AI-resistant skills: Client communication, Creative concept development, Complex problem-solving, Floral arrangement artistry. These skills are harder for AI to replicate and will remain valuable as automation increases.
Based on transferable skills, event decorators can transition to: Interior Designer (50% AI risk, medium transition); Event Planner (50% AI risk, easy transition); Floral Designer (50% AI risk, medium transition). These alternatives leverage existing expertise while offering different risk profiles.
